The Prince of Astoria-Chapter 83: LXXXIII - Bomb Proof
Gabe rushed into Etienne’s room, nearly busting the door down as Etienne napped.
Etienne sat up in a panic and grabbed his sword from the side of his bed immediately, "What’s going on? What happened?"
Gabe held his cell phone horizontally and showed it to Etienne.
"Bomb Proof just went live. Does this place look familiar to you?"
On the screen, Bomb Proof stood confidently in the middle of the sidewalk. wore a red turtleneck sweater that hugged the curves of her body and oversized black sweatpants, along with strange looking black boots. Blue and red wiring ran through them, just under the surface.
Behind Bomb Proof was a familiar looking demolished building.
"Turn the volume up," Etienne requested, "What’s she saying?"
Gabe pressed the volume button on his phone and allowed Bomb Proof’s voice to echo through the room.
"I wonder if any heroes will show? I wonder if they care? The Dark Pattern stands for the perserverance and strength of humanity, and we stand against the reckless use of power and glory hunting of the heroes!"
Bomb Proof gestured to the razed building behind her, "This is what happens when that power goes unchecked. Wanton destruction. This could be your business. Or your home, with your kids in it. Turned into collateral damage of a metahuman battle. Just like GoGo’s Girls, which used to be a personal favorite of mine."
Etienne stood up and grabbed a black surgical mask off of a stack of them sitting on his desk.
"She wants a hero to come right?" Etienne muttered, "Hopefully she’s fine with a former hero."
____________________________________________________________
Etienne stood on top of a roof adjacent to the demolished building. Bomb Proof stood right in front of building, surrounded by a small crowd of people all holding their phones. She spoke passionately and emphatically, her words inciting cheers from the crowd.
Etienne scoffed and thought to himself, "Charisma."
He jumped down off the building and landed a few feet away from Bomb Proof and the crowd. The crowd parted as he walked through and approached Bomb Proof.
"Ninjaman," She stated dryly, "I’m glad you made it. The reponse time of heroes leaves a bit to be desired..but good job nonetheless."
Etienne put his hand over his sword, "Ms. Bomb Proof. I heard you calling for a hero to come out here. Why?"
A small smile spread across Bomb Proof’s face, "I want to fight you Ninjaman. But not with that," She pointed at Ninjaman’s sword, "Hand-to-hand. I’m powerless, so that’s a bit more fair, no?"
"I’m powerless too, technically," Etienne though to himself, "But I’m tired of repeating that."
Etienne moved his hand away from his sword and crossed his arms, "It’s still not very fair if I’m being honest. I’m a hand-to-hand combat expert. What purpose does this serve?"
Bomb Proof cracked her knuckles, "We all have to test our mettle Ninjaman. As a human, you have to do it at least once, so you know where you really stand. You get that, don’t you?"
Etienne stared at her silently.
Bomb Proof stretched, "I haven’t fought a hero in years, since I first started streaming. And they were only rank 220 or so. You’re the perfect target Ninjaman. You’re a contract hero, but it’s no secret if you were ranked, you’d be in the top 100. Hell, based on what I’ve seen and read, I think you’d be top 50 easily."
The crowd let a collective noise of surprise at the comment.
"I’m serious!" Bomb Proof called out, "That’s why, if I can hold a candle against you, then I want to prove once and for all that normal humans can do anything, as long as they persevere and put their mind to it. I can prove human tenacity can beat metahuman power."
Etienne looked around at the crowd surrounding them. They were all enthralled and engaged, like they were watching a stage play.
"Isn’t that what you did when you first came here?" Bomb Proof questioned, "You fought GoGo’s disciples to test your mettle, to prove yourself right?"
Etienne glared at her, "You don’t know anything about that. They were threatening people, hurting people. I had to step in."
Bomb Proof snickered, "Is that so? You know, I was there that night, When you destroyed the power and gassed out the building."
Etienne narrowed his eyes, "You...were?"
Bomb Proof paced in a small circle, "Why do you think I’m here? Do you think we always stream in front of demolished buildings? Today is the six month anniversary of that night. The night sixteen people were hospitalized, and one young man with a promising future died."
Bomb Proof tapped her chin and added, "Or maybe I should say killed. Because that’s what you did right? You killed him? Have you thought about that kid’s death at all or was it just another inconsequential event to you? Just a necessary step in your mission as a hero?"
Someone from the crowd tossed a backpack at Bomb Proof and she caught it with one hand. She set it down on the ground and looked up at Etienne, "You’re a human, so we know the answer to that question already. Of course you don’t care. But with all that said, I really just want to see if I’m as good as you. Or if you’re really as good as they say."
Etienne dropped into a battle position. Bomb Proof unzipped the bag and reached her hand into it. She carefully pulled out a pair of futuristic looking grey boots with glowing buttons and switches on them.
She slipped the futuristic boots on over the boots she was wearing and kicked the ground a bit, testing the feel.
"I know on my streams we usually just have fun, showing off gadgets is more Terminator’s thing. But Yorrk gave me a special gift, I want to show it off. This is what human effort can produce. Everybody, check out my Fuzzy Boots," She pointed someone in the crowd holding an expensive looking camera, "Make sure you clip this."
Etienne lunged forward and unleashed a flurry of punches. Bomb Proof was mostly unsuccessful in blocking the blows and was pushed back. She regained her balance and glared at Etienne. Bruises already started to form on her face and her forearms.
Bomb Proof answered back with her own flurry of relentless kicks, coming from different angles and directions. The kicks were surprisingly fast, and only continued to increase in speed as she continued.
Etienne blocked them easily for a while, but after a while some of the kicks broke through his defense and hit him.
"It’s not just the boots, she’s skilled. Is this...taekwondo?" Etienne thought to himself, "She’s still not all that strong though. I should just subdue her and make her tell me where the other members are."
Etienne dodged one of her kicks and grabbed her leg. Bomb Proof slipped out of the grab easily and jumped into the air. She spun around, intending to hit Etienne with a devastating kick.
Without thinking, Etienne just barely avoided the kick and drew his sword. He slashed and in one swift motion, he sheathed his sword again.
Bomb Proof landed on the ground roughly. She watched in horror as the Fuzzy Boots split apart, both of them sliced perfectly through the middle.
"What did you—" She barely choked out.
As Etienne looked down at Bomb Proof and her boots, something sharp struck Etienne in the back and cause him to fall to one knee.
Etienne looked down at his stomach and spotted a large metal stake penetrating him.
Behind him, a young man threw a large device down and wiped his hands.
"That’ll probably be the last time I use that, thankfully," The man spoke with a concerningly deep voice, "Reloading that thing is a hassle."
Behind him, a man in khaki pants and a clean white button up stared down at Etienne. The man adjusted his black tie, loosening it slightly. A bronze orb floated just over his shoulder.
"Hey Ninjaman. That’s not gonna kill you, right?" He asked nonchalantly.
Etienne pursed his lips together and pushed the stake out of his stomach. He held one hand over the one and held his sword with the other, pointing it at Yorrk.
"If you know what’s good for you, you wouldn’t point that sword at me. I don’t have anymore weapons for you, but I do know a few secrets about you that would do just as much damage. Courtesy of our mutual friend Code Talker."
Etienne snarled and continued to point the sword at him. He circled Yorrk.
Yorrk put his hands up, "If you hurt me or threaten me too much, I may be more inclined to share what I learned. I know the crowd here would love for me to air a heroes dirty laundry."
Yorrk motioned to the crowd and they cheered loudly. He smiled and continued, "And I’m sure the stream would love to hear it as well. So Ninjaman, what’ll it be?"
